Home
last modified time | relevance | path

Searched refs:Vibrator (Results 1 – 13 of 13) sorted by relevance

/hardware/interfaces/vibrator/1.3/example/
DVibrator.cpp32 Vibrator::Vibrator() { in Vibrator() function in android::hardware::vibrator::V1_3::implementation::Vibrator
46 Return<Status> Vibrator::on(uint32_t timeoutMs) { in on()
50 Return<Status> Vibrator::off() { in off()
54 Return<bool> Vibrator::supportsAmplitudeControl() { in supportsAmplitudeControl()
58 Return<Status> Vibrator::setAmplitude(uint8_t amplitude) { in setAmplitude()
67 Return<void> Vibrator::perform(V1_0::Effect effect, EffectStrength strength, perform_cb _hidl_cb) { in perform()
73 Return<void> Vibrator::perform_1_1(V1_1::Effect_1_1 effect, EffectStrength strength, in perform_1_1()
80 Return<void> Vibrator::perform_1_2(V1_2::Effect effect, EffectStrength strength, in perform_1_2()
87 Return<bool> Vibrator::supportsExternalControl() { in supportsExternalControl()
91 Return<Status> Vibrator::setExternalControl(bool enabled) { in setExternalControl()
[all …]
Dservice.cpp26 using android::hardware::vibrator::V1_3::implementation::Vibrator;
30 sp<IVibrator> vibrator = new Vibrator(); in registerVibratorService()
DVibrator.h31 class Vibrator : public IVibrator {
33 Vibrator();
DAndroid.bp22 srcs: ["service.cpp", "Vibrator.cpp"],
/hardware/interfaces/vibrator/1.0/default/
DVibrator.cpp34 Vibrator::Vibrator(vibrator_device_t *device) : mDevice(device) {} in Vibrator() function in android::hardware::vibrator::V1_0::implementation::Vibrator
37 Return<Status> Vibrator::on(uint32_t timeout_ms) { in on()
46 Return<Status> Vibrator::off() { in off()
55 Return<bool> Vibrator::supportsAmplitudeControl() { in supportsAmplitudeControl()
59 Return<Status> Vibrator::setAmplitude(uint8_t) { in setAmplitude()
63 Return<void> Vibrator::perform(Effect, EffectStrength, perform_cb _hidl_cb) { in perform()
83 return new Vibrator(vib_device); in HIDL_FETCH_IVibrator()
DVibrator.h29 struct Vibrator : public IVibrator { struct
30 Vibrator(vibrator_device_t *device);
DAndroid.bp21 srcs: ["Vibrator.cpp"],
/hardware/interfaces/vibrator/aidl/default/
DVibrator.cpp30 ndk::ScopedAStatus Vibrator::getCapabilities(int32_t* _aidl_return) { in getCapabilities()
39 ndk::ScopedAStatus Vibrator::off() { in off()
44 ndk::ScopedAStatus Vibrator::on(int32_t timeoutMs, in on()
60 ndk::ScopedAStatus Vibrator::perform(Effect effect, EffectStrength strength, in perform()
88 ndk::ScopedAStatus Vibrator::getSupportedEffects(std::vector<Effect>* _aidl_return) { in getSupportedEffects()
93 ndk::ScopedAStatus Vibrator::setAmplitude(float amplitude) { in setAmplitude()
101 ndk::ScopedAStatus Vibrator::setExternalControl(bool enabled) { in setExternalControl()
106 ndk::ScopedAStatus Vibrator::getCompositionDelayMax(int32_t* maxDelayMs) { in getCompositionDelayMax()
111 ndk::ScopedAStatus Vibrator::getCompositionSizeMax(int32_t* maxSize) { in getCompositionSizeMax()
116 ndk::ScopedAStatus Vibrator::getSupportedPrimitives(std::vector<CompositePrimitive>* supported) { in getSupportedPrimitives()
[all …]
Dmain.cpp23 using aidl::android::hardware::vibrator::Vibrator;
27 std::shared_ptr<Vibrator> vib = ndk::SharedRefBase::make<Vibrator>(); in main()
29 const std::string instance = std::string() + Vibrator::descriptor + "/default"; in main()
DAndroid.bp10 srcs: ["Vibrator.cpp"],
/hardware/interfaces/tests/extension/vibrator/aidl/default/
Dservice.cpp25 using aidl::android::hardware::vibrator::Vibrator;
33 std::shared_ptr<Vibrator> vib = ndk::SharedRefBase::make<Vibrator>(); in main()
42 const std::string instance = std::string() + Vibrator::descriptor + "/default"; in main()
/hardware/interfaces/vibrator/aidl/default/include/vibrator-impl/
DVibrator.h26 class Vibrator : public BnVibrator {
/hardware/interfaces/vibrator/aidl/vts/
DVtsHalVibratorTargetTest.cpp461 INSTANTIATE_TEST_SUITE_P(Vibrator, VibratorAidl,